AWS Certified DevOps Engineer – Professional

Visit

Validates ability to deliver and manage continuous delivery systems using AWS. It is ideal for testers transitioning to DevOps as it covers deployment, monitoring, and incident response, requiring deep understanding of AWS services and automation tools.

Certified Kubernetes Administrator (CKA)

Visit

A hands-on, performance-based exam confirming expertise in Kubernetes cluster architecture and administration. This certification is crucial for modern DevOps roles, as container orchestration has become a standard requirement for deployment and scaling tasks.

Docker Certified Associate (DCA)

Visit

Demonstrates proficiency in building, shipping, and running distributed applications using Docker. It provides a foundational understanding of containerization, which is a critical first step for QA engineers moving into container-centric DevOps environments.

HashiCorp Terraform Associate

Visit

Certifies skills in provisioning and managing infrastructure as code using Terraform. It is highly relevant for testers moving into DevOps who need to automate environment setup, ensuring consistency between development, testing, and production stages.

Microsoft Azure DevOps Engineer Expert (AZ-400)

Visit

Validates expertise in designing and implementing strategies for collaboration, code, infrastructure, and source control. This certification helps testers understand end-to-end DevOps lifecycle management within the Microsoft Azure ecosystem.

Jenkins Certification (JCE)

Visit

Focuses on implementing CI/CD pipelines using Jenkins, a widely used automation server. For testers with experience in manual or automated testing, this certification bridges the gap to building and maintaining automated build and test pipelines.

CompTIA DevOps+ Certification

Visit

A vendor-neutral certification covering core DevOps principles, culture, and automation. It is excellent for entry-level transitions, helping QA professionals understand the broader DevOps mindset and basic toolchain integration without vendor lock-in.

GitLab Certified Associate

Visit

Validates ability to use GitLab for DevOps lifecycle activities, including CI/CD, security, and version control. It is particularly useful for teams using GitLab, offering a focused path to mastering their specific platform's automation capabilities.

Red Hat Certified Engineer in DevOps (RHCE)

Visit

Focuses on automation using Ansible within Red Hat Enterprise Linux environments. It is highly respected in enterprise settings, helping testers with Linux experience transition into roles requiring configuration management and automated patching.

Splunk Core Certified Power User

Visit

Covers data collection, analysis, and visualization using Splunk, a key tool for monitoring and logging. DevOps roles often require analyzing logs for debugging and performance, making this a valuable skill for testers expanding into operations.

Prometheus Certified Associate

Visit

Validates ability to use Prometheus for monitoring and alerting in cloud-native environments. As observability becomes central to DevOps, this certification helps testers understand how to implement metrics and alerts for application health.

Linux Professional Institute Certification (LPIC-1)

Visit

Provides foundational Linux administration skills, which are essential for most DevOps roles. Understanding the Linux kernel, command line, and system administration helps testers troubleshoot infrastructure issues in automated environments.
